On Mon, Dec 01, 2008 at 11:44:08AM +0000, [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: > Replace my_snprintf with plain sprintf because my_snprintf from pport.h is > slow, especially for threaded perls (14% of pp_entersub_profiler), > and we don't need the extra safety as there's no risk of overflow.
However, (if we care), by assuming the return value of sprintf() to be ANSI conformant, we're breaking SunOS support. Then again, the only two people to report to perl5-porters about building on SunOS in the past 18 months both failed to reply to requests for more information, so I suspect that Perl 5 currently doesn't build on SunOS.
